Announcements and Miscellaneous. <br />Mr. Oxian moved that the Bauman House, located at 60+13 Sumption Trail, <br />be recommended to the County Council for designation as an historic <br />landmark. Some discussion ensued as to whether such a recommendation <br />should be postponed until the procedures of the proposed Resolution #1 <br />be passed by the Commission. Ms. Sporleder seconded the motion and it <br />passed unanimously. <br />12.
